Hopefully we can stabilize around here and not grind lower. Its just such a tough market for equities at the moment.

In my mind, the real question however is: When will record high gold prices start being priced into the share prices of quality junior with real gold properties? I mean, Barrick's and Goldcorp's of the world are near 52-week highs but the juniors keep floundering. I see why the big guys appreciate first, they are currently producing gold; so I have no problem with that. But the juniors are so cheap when will they get snapped up??
